|a Semantic Web and Web Science focuses on exploring�state of the art research in semantic web and web science. The rapidly evolving�World Wide Web�has led to revolutionary changes in the whole of society. The research and development of the semantic web covers a number of global standards of the web and cutting edge technologies, such as: linked data, social semantic web, semantic web search, smart data integration, semantic web mining and web scale computing.� These proceedings are from the Sixth Chinese Semantic Web Symposium.
